TRICARE Dental Program
The TRICARE Dental Program is a voluntary dental plan. Sponsors can enroll through milConnect.
You can enroll if you’re a:
- Family member of an active duty service member
- Family member of a National Guard or Reserve member
- National Guard or Reserve Member who isn’t on active duty or covered by the Transitional Assistance Management Program
- You get active duty dental benefits if you’re on active duty orders for more than 30 days or covered by TAMP.
Dental Contractor
United Concordia administers the TDP benefit. After you enroll, you can create an account with United Concordia. You’ll need a DS Logon to create your account. You can use your account to:
- View dental coverage.
- Check a claim.
- View claims history.
- View explanation of benefits.
- Register a chronic condition, pregnancy or special need.
- Choose communication preferences (such as text, email, or mail).
- Access messages in a secure Messaging Center.

Disenrollment
You can disenroll from the TDP by completing a new TRICARE Dental Program Enrollment/Change Authorization Form. Your coverage ends depending on when your form is received. You may be able to disenroll through milConnect.
Minimum Enrollment Period
You must enroll for a minimum of 12 months.
- Your sponsor must have 12 months remaining on their service commitment.
- You must complete the first 12 month enrollment unless you have a valid reason to end coverage.
- After the 12-month period, you can continue on a month-to-month basis.
View the TRICARE Dental Program Handbook for exceptions to the minimum enrollment period.
Plan Options
The TDP has two options:
- Single (one person)
- Family (two or more people)
- If you choose a family plan, all eligible family members must enroll except:
- Children under age 1. If you have a family plan, your children will be automatically on the family plan on the first day of the month after they reach age 1.
- Family members living in two or more locations.
- Family members who need special medical attention in a hospital or treatment center (you must have documentation).
National Guard or Reserve enrollments work a little differently. Sponsors enroll separately because their military status may change.
- The sponsor and family members enroll separately and pay two different premium payments.
- The sponsor can only select a single plan.
- Family members can enroll under a single or family plan.
- The sponsor doesn't have to have a plan for families to enroll.
Do you need an annual dental exam for dental readiness? TDP network dentists can complete the Department of Defense Active Duty/Reserve/Guard/Civilian Forces Examination form (DD 2813) for you at no cost.
Coverage
When you send your TDP enrollment form, United Concordia will:
- See if you’re eligible.
- Check that your premium payment is correct.
- Process your enrollment.
- Contact you if there are any problems.
If your enrollment is received:
- By the 20th of the month, your coverage starts on the first day of the next month.
- After the 20th of the month, your coverage starts on the first day of the second month.
- See the chart below for samples enrollment start dates.
Important: If you get any dental care before your start date, you’ll have to pay for the full cost of your care.
| Date Verified | Enrollment Starts |
|---|---|
| Dec. 21–Jan. 20 | Feb. 1 |
| Jan. 21–Feb. 20 | March 1 |
| Feb. 21–March 20 | April 1 |
| March 21–April 20 | May 1 |
| April 21–May 20 | June 1 |
| May 21–June 20 | July 1 |
| June 21–July 20 | Aug. 1 |
| July 21–Aug. 20 | Sept. 1 |
| Aug. 21–Sept. 20 | Oct. 1 |
| Sept. 21–Oct. 20 | Nov. 1 |
| Oct. 21–Nov. 20 | Dec. 1 |
| Nov. 21–Dec. 20 | Jan. 1 |
